Contract Administrator Jobs in Washington, DC

A Contract Administrator in the construction industry is responsible for managing all contracts related to a specific project. This includes preparing, examining, proposing, and revising contracts that involve purchases of materials or services, leases, licenses, or other agreements. They ensure that all contracts are in compliance with legal requirements and company policies. Their role is crucial in coordinating the execution of contracts, monitoring their fulfillment, and documenting and communicating on any potential contract breaches.

Important skills for a Contract Administrator include strong attention to detail, excellent negotiation skills, and a deep understanding of contract law. They should preferably hold a degree in Business Administration, Law, or a related field. Certifications such as Certified Professional Contracts Manager (CPCM), Certified Federal Contracts Manager (CFCM), or Certified Commercial Contracts Manager (CCCM) are considered beneficial in this role. Before becoming a Contract Administrator, a person may have roles such as a Contract Analyst, Procurement Specialist, or Project Coordinator in the construction industry.

Highest Education Level

Contract Administrators in Washington, DC offer the following education background
Bachelor's Degree
37.5%
High School or GED
16.4%
Master's Degree
14.9%
Vocational Degree or Certification
13.5%
Associate's Degree
12.5%
Some College
2.8%
Doctorate Degree
1.9%
Some High School
0.6%

Average Work Experience
Here's a breakdown of the number of years' experience offered by Contract Administrators in Washington, DC
4-6 years
45.4%
2-4 years
27.3%
6-8 years
9.1%
None
9.1%
1-2 years
4.6%
10+ years
4.6%
